Nadav Rotem authored
The DAGCombiner folds the zext into complex load instructions. This patch prevents this optimization on vectors since none of the supported targets knows how to perform load+vector_zext in one instruction. llvm-svn: 126080

Jakob Stoklund Olesen authored
The rewriter works almost identically to -rewriter=trivial, except it also eliminates any identity copies. This makes the new register allocators independent of VirtRegRewriter.cpp which will be going away at the same time as RegAllocLinearScan. llvm-svn: 125967

Jakob Stoklund Olesen authored
A local live range is live in a single basic block. If such a range fails to allocate, try to find a sub-range that would get a larger spill weight than its interference. llvm-svn: 125764

Devang Patel authored
Ignore DBG_VALUE machine instructions while constructing instruction ranges based on location info. Machine instruction range consisting of only DBG_VALUE MIs only contributes consecutive labels in assembly output, which is harmless, and empty scope entry in DebugInfo, which confuses debugger tools. llvm-svn: 125577

Jakob Stoklund Olesen authored
Simplify the spill weight calculation a bit by bypassing getApproximateInstructionCount() and using LiveInterval::getSize() directly. This changes the computed spill weights, but only by a constant factor in each function. It should not affect how spill weights compare against each other, and so it shouldn't affect code generation. llvm-svn: 125530
